Forecast Snow Stability: Main snow accumulations will be in high North and East facing corries. The snowpack will be generally refrozen and stable, although some slight softening may occur during Friday afternoon. The avalanche hazard will be Low.
Snowpack Structure
Forecast Weather Influences: It will be dry with the freezing level gradually rising to around 1000 metres during the period. Light to moderate Westerly winds over the summits. Observed Weather Influences: It has been a dry day with the freezing level around 650 metres. Light winds. ObservedSnowStability: The main snowpack remains in high North and East facing corries. The snowpack is frozen and stable. There is a very light dusting of fresh snow, but this is not significant. The avalanche hazard is Low.
